如何使用Python函数来显示当前时间?
发布时间:2023-11-25 20:51:22
要显示当前时间,可以使用Python的内置模块datetime来实现。下面是使用Python函数来显示当前时间的步骤:
1. 导入datetime模块:首先要导入datetime模块,该模块提供了一些函数和类来处理日期和时间。
import datetime
2. 使用datetime.now()函数获取当前日期和时间:datetime模块中的now()函数返回当前日期和时间的datetime对象。
current_time = datetime.datetime.now()
3. 格式化输出当前时间:要将当前时间以特定格式显示,可以使用strftime()函数来格式化datetime对象。
formatted_time = current_time.strftime("%Y-%m-%d %H:%M:%S")
print("当前时间:", formatted_time)
这里的"%Y-%m-%d %H:%M:%S"是格式化字符串,具体含义如下:
- "%Y":年份,如2021
- "%m":月份,如09
- "%d":日期,如13
- "%H":小时,如14
- "%M":分钟,如30
- "%S":秒钟,如59
可以根据需要自定义格式化字符串来显示时间。
完整代码示例:
import datetime
current_time = datetime.datetime.now()
formatted_time = current_time.strftime("%Y-%m-%d %H:%M:%S")
print("当前时间:", formatted_time)
运行代码,将会输出当前的日期和时间,如:当前时间:2021-09-13 14:30:59。
另外,还可以使用Python第三方库如arrow、pytz等来处理日期和时间,这些库提供了更多的功能和操作,可以根据实际需求选择使用。
